FFTmetrology HemQC

Concept

  • Quality measurement for various types of roller hemming with laser light section sensor
  • scanning system for optical 3D detection of:
    • Seam geometries
    • sealing adhesive
  • Detection of position, height, width and adhesive exit
  • Detection of gaps, insufficient volume, incorrect position of the sealing adhesive

Technical specifications

  • Measuring frequency 200 images / seconds
  • Resolution up to 0.8 µm (numerical resolution)
  • ±0.2 mm accuracy drop width, drop height and adhesive height
  • ±0.4 mm accuracy adhesive width and better (depending on the characteristic)

Know-how Universal hemming inspection for maximum data acquisition

A scanning system for optical 3D acquisition is used to ensure the highest quality standards in roll hemming processes. A laser light section sensor is used to measure hemming geometries and adhesive seals precisely and without contact. The system reliably records the position, height, width and any adhesive leakage.

In addition to geometric analysis, this fold control also enables the detection of critical quality characteristics such as gaps in the seal, insufficient adhesive volume or incorrectly positioned sealing adhesive. Precise 3D capture enables continuous inline monitoring, which detects errors at an early stage and thus ensures stable, reproducible production quality.

The measurement data from the hemming inspection forms the basis for efficient process control and documented quality assurance – tailored to different types of roll hemming and adhesive technologies.

Installation of the FFTmetrology HemQC Equipment

Hardware

  • Single line laser: FFTBlue
  • Panel PC or BoxPC
  • Ethernet, TCP/IP communication
  • Various robots and controllers can be used

Software

  • FFT VisionAnalyser, VisionGuide for measurement and communication
  • VisionReport HemQC for visualization
  • MySQL, MariaDB, MSSQL can be used as a database
  • Communication package for the robot

Installation of the FFTmetrology HemQC Simple implementation in 4 steps

Roller fold production

First, the fold is produced in three passes (folding speed 100 mm/sec.). The roller hemming measurement then takes place in the third pass.

Measuring rate and quality visualization

Recording of one image per millimeter. The fold quality is then visualized using red, yellow and green markings.

Link with PLC

These visualized results are sent to the software under the following identifiers and saved as a database:

  • IO - OK
  • NiO - not OK
  • Incorrect measurement

 

Final quality report

The software can be used to evaluate the recorded measurements using various statistical methods.
